Key Success Metrics for Your Life Science R&D Facilities
- Lab Asset Uptime
Maintaining uptime is crucial in managing specialized laboratory equipment due to the critical nature of scientific operations. Downtime can disrupt essential procedures, from experimental research to breakthrough scientific discoveries, potentially causing significant financial losses and damaging the institution's reputation. Metrics such as first-time fix and self-maintenance rates are important to consider, as they provide insight into the efficiency and effectiveness of the current equipment maintenance strategies. - Time Given Back to Science
Freeing researchers from operational burdens means faster, better breakthroughs. By streamlining non-core activities—such as procurement, maintenance, and troubleshooting—scientists are granted greater focus on their research endeavors. This shift not only accelerates research velocity but also enhances the quality of scientific output, as talent is devoted to innovation rather than distractions. This metric serves as a barometer for the facility’s ability to nurture a productive research environment. - Maintenance Expenditure
Maintenance costs stand as a critical indicator of a life sciences R&D facility’s operational effectiveness and long-term viability. A strategic approach to maintenance can extend equipment lifespan, translating into significant savings over time. Insights gleaned from maintenance costs bolster budgeting strategies, enhancing the facility's sustainability and operational resilience.

Common Operational Risks and How To Avoid Them
- Temperature Control Failures
Maintaining precise refrigeration temperatures within R&D laboratories is critical for safeguarding the integrity of samples and reagents. Fluctuations in temperature can lead to degradation, compromising the viability of biological samples and the reliability of experimental results. Regular monitoring and maintenance of refrigeration units are essential to mitigate this risk. Implementing advanced temperature monitoring systems with real-time alerts can ensure prompt responses to deviations, thereby preserving research quality and integrity. - No Redundancies or Fail-Safes
The absence of redundancies and fail-safe systems in laboratory settings exposes organizations to significant risks, potentially leading to catastrophic failures that compromise critical research data and personnel safety. Unforeseen incidents, such as power outages or equipment malfunctions, can disrupt operations and incur substantial financial losses. Establishing robust redundancies, conducting routine system checks, and devising comprehensive contingency plans are vital for ensuring operational resilience and safeguarding research continuity. - Lack of Alignment Between R&D and CRE
A lack of alignment between life sciences R&D and CRE&F departments can result in inefficient resource utilization and hinder innovation through miscommunication and conflict. Involving R&D personnel in decision-making processes related to facility changes is essential for addressing their specific requirements. Establishing robust communication channels and fostering collaboration among all stakeholders can enhance productivity and create an environment conducive to innovation, ultimately aligning operations with organizational goals.
